Output 43d66ac65a7c30961895e183205676131e6d24d6c0409bad54cddf9c4248f602:161

value
10972956
script pubkey
OP_0 OP_PUSHBYTES_20 a04cfb0cfa6a296d3b242bac237e0d61bb2aeaef
address
bc1q5px0kr86dg5k6wey9wkzxlsdvxaj46h0evee88
transaction
43d66ac65a7c30961895e183205676131e6d24d6c0409bad54cddf9c4248f602